Prediction Method · The Rubric

How each model turns a market into a number: the sport-tiered criteria rubric

Every model on the panel scores the same market against the same factors, in the same order, on the same scale. That is what makes dozens of different models comparable: their confidence is not a gut feeling, it is a weighted average of explicit judgments. The twelve below are the universal core that every sport shares, drawn from A structured set of factors; tennis, baseball and football each add their own tier on top. Each factor is scored from 0 to 1 toward the model's own pick, where 0.5 means unknown and is dropped so it cannot dilute the signal. Factors are weighted by how reliably they predict, so a market-edge read counts far more than a weather note.

FactorWhat it evaluatesWeight
Market edgeThe model's fair-value estimate versus the market-implied price. The strongest reality-check on raw opinion.
0.15
Injuries & availabilityWho is out, questionable, or returning; roster availability at tip-off.
0.12
Kelly sizingAn edge-magnitude check: how large a position the estimated edge actually justifies.
0.12
Record & formWin/loss record and results across recent games.
0.10
MomentumHot or cold trend beyond raw record; win streaks.
0.09
Head-to-headPrior matchups between the two sides.
0.08
Calibration vs historyThe model's own historical accuracy on similar markets. Its track record grades its own confidence.
0.08
Home / awayVenue and home-field advantage.
0.07
Rest & scheduleBack-to-backs, travel, and schedule congestion.
0.06
Sentiment & newsPublic sentiment, quotes, morale, and line-movement signal.
0.05
Age & peak windowCareer stage and physical peak.
0.05
Weather & conditionsWind, rain, temperature, and venue conditions.
0.03
Weighted averageHow the score forms

The factor scores combine into a single quant confidence by weighted average. Factors scored 0.5 (unknown) are excluded from both sides of the ratio, so missing information lowers certainty instead of faking it.

Sixty / forty blendDiscipline without robotics

Final confidence is 0.6 times the quant score plus 0.4 times the model's own stated confidence. The rubric keeps models honest; the blend keeps their genuine read in the mix.

Edge gates & capsOverconfidence brakes

A tiny edge is forced to match the market near 0.60; a larger edge earns more; an oversized claimed edge is penalized because it historically underperforms. Weak-history leagues carry hard confidence caps.

Fed back, then re-weightedClosing the loop

Once a market resolves, the calibration factor and the panel weights update from what actually happened, so the same factors are scored a little more wisely next time.

Design Rationale · 03

Memory architecture: vector retrieval and a marker ledger

Similarity memory and durable event history answer different questions. Storage dimensions, table inventories, and private deployment details are omitted.

Vector MemoryWhat it remembers

Operator trades, unusual plays, per-model accuracy, chat Q&A, error-to-fix pairs, game outcomes, news sentiment, model-meeting insights, market text, and lifecycle evidence. Each table answers one recall question well.

Vector similarity indexingWhy this index

High-dimension embeddings exceed the standard HNSW limit, so vectors are indexed as half-precision with cosine ops. Approximate search trades recall, latency, and storage; validate the choice on representative queries.

Marker LedgerHow history survives

Every reset, graft, sweep and bundle writes one typed, additive row. Vectors answer "what is similar"; the marker ledger answers "what happened to this seat, and when." Nothing is ever mutated, so a reset is a time floor rather than a deletion.

Redis LayerWhy chosen

In-memory cache, cross-restart alert dedup, and signal pub/sub. Notifications survive restarts without double-firing, and hot data never touches the database.

Backup & ReplicationWhy chosen

Git history alone does not back up a database, secrets or runtime state, so backup and restore are documented separately and audited by a read-only readiness check. Recovery is a written runbook, not an assumption.

Retrieval DisciplineWhy chosen

Recall is filtered by distance thresholds and hit counters, cached answers are reused when close enough, and repeated model discussions are deduplicated before they waste tokens.

Design Rationale · 06

Risk, safety & release discipline: engineered like it can fail

An autonomous system touching real markets gets the full defensive stack: position sizing with hard caps, multi-level kill switches, strict separation between simulated and real money, injection-scrubbed prompts, masked errors, authenticated surfaces, and a public boundary designed so leaking is structurally difficult.

Sizing DisciplineControl

Fractional Kelly sizing with a hard per-position cap, confidence-tier stake ladders, and minimum edge and expected-value floors before any stake is placed.

Hard BrakesControl

Automatic staking halts at the model, league, and model-league level when resolved win rates or P&L fall below floors. Plus a pause flag and a phone-side switch that stops the whole stack.

Paper-Real SeparationControl

Models trade virtual per-model bankrolls. Real accounts are tracked read-only, live actions require operator approval, and the browser execution bridge ships hard-capped and disabled by default.

Design Rationale · 07

One market, end to end

An illustrative path from a research question to a reviewed outcome.

Ingest

Markets stream in from the prediction venue through a whitelisted, deduplicated API client and land in Postgres with full provenance. Each of the four verticals has its own door, and every one of them fails closed on stale data.

Enrich

Sharp sportsbook lines, injury and lineup intelligence, live scores, websocket prices, and cited web research attach context to each market.

Recall

The vector brain surfaces similar past situations and their outcomes; the marker ledger contributes what has already happened to this seat, including any reset or graft.

Vote

The full panel runs the sport-tiered criteria rubric in parallel and each seat commits to a pick. A seat that does not answer is marked synthetic and excluded from every money query.

Grade

The golden-play contract decides whether this is a badge-worthy play: enough distinct voters, enough agreement, a licensed sample, and a published rate only ever beside the price-implied baseline.

Gate

Risk controls apply: confidence, edge, and expected-value floors, fractional Kelly sizing, stake ladders, hard brakes, and operator approval for anything real.

Resolve

Monitors track every open position, resolve outcomes API-first with model fallback, and stamp each prediction with its result.

Learn

Calibration updates, rankings move, embeddings absorb the outcome, and the substrate census records which learning stage actually ran. Where the evidence clears its floor, a losing seat is reset and re-taught the leading seat's method.
